Some public monuments:
The Women’s Military Service Monument honors Delaware women who have served or are serving in the military, as well as those who supported military efforts in non‑combat or home front roles—for example, working as Red Cross nurses, in munitions factories, etc
The WWI Memorial honoring Delaware’s WWI veterans and those who served on the home front was unveiled on the grounds of Legislative Hall in Dover.
